In the vast universe of television series, 'Dr. Phil' stands as one of the most iconic and engaging talk shows of its time. Created by Oprah Winfrey and hosted by renowned psychologist Phil McGraw, this long-running show has undoubtedly left an indelible mark on audiences worldwide.
Running for a spectacular 20 seasons with over 3512 episodes, 'Dr. Phil' made its debut on September 16, 2002. The series was born from McGraw's successful segments on 'The Oprah Winfrey Show', where he offered advice in form of 'life strategies'. These strategies were derived from his extensive background as a clinical psychologist and have since become a hallmark of 'Dr. Phil'.
